Output e4f3ed28f7c375a6132973481e2c5daf7b99e1fc49d47962a4f3a74711ece905:1

value
7383966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15af9dce882b395fa79b30511bae35b21bd8c042 OP_EQUAL
address
33fgVcfycn1BK22HjeoSLLkwzuzyhRzjBg
transaction
e4f3ed28f7c375a6132973481e2c5daf7b99e1fc49d47962a4f3a74711ece905
spent
true